Stabbing Suspect Arrested Without Incident

Stabbing suspect, Jamie Lee Saulteaux has been arrested thanks to a concerned citizen.

On Tuesday, August 18, 2020, shortly before 11:00 a.m., a concerned citizen observed a female matching the description of the suspect involved in the early morning stabbing incident. She was standing outside a residence in the area of Arther Avenue North and Wilson Street. The citizen had seen the suspect's image on a social media post from Hamilton Police. Police were notified and immediately attended the location. The identity of the female was confirmed and she was arrested without incident. At the time of her arrest, Saulteaux was in possession of a weapon. The investigation continues as detectives work to confirm it was the weapon used in the assault.

The victim continues to receive treatment for his injuries and his condition has been upgraded. 

Jamie Lee Saulteaux will have heard matter heard at the John Sopinka Courthouse on Wednesday, August 19, 2020. 

Hamilton Police would like to thank everyone who assisted with this investigation.
